Timing Post-Waxing: Optimal wait time before starting red light therapy after waxing for skin safety

Post-waxing skin is particularly sensitive, making the timing of subsequent treatments like red light therapy crucial for safety and efficacy. Waxing removes hair at the root, causing micro-trauma to the skin, which can lead to redness, inflammation, or even minor abrasions. Red light therapy, known for its anti-inflammatory and healing properties, might seem like an immediate solution, but starting too soon could exacerbate irritation rather than soothe it. Understanding the optimal wait time ensures you maximize benefits without compromising skin health.

From an analytical perspective, the skin’s recovery timeline post-waxing varies depending on factors like skin type, waxing technique, and individual sensitivity. Generally, the skin needs 24 to 48 hours to recover from the stress of waxing. During this period, the epidermis repairs itself, and inflammation subsides. Red light therapy, which operates at wavelengths between 630 to 660 nanometers (red) and 810 to 850 nanometers (near-infrared), penetrates the skin to stimulate collagen production and reduce inflammation. However, applying this treatment too soon can overwhelm the skin’s healing process, potentially leading to prolonged redness or discomfort.

Instructively, waiting at least 24 hours after waxing before starting red light therapy is a safe guideline for most individuals. For those with particularly sensitive skin or prone to post-waxing irritation, extending this wait time to 48 hours is advisable. During this interim, focus on gentle skincare practices: avoid harsh exfoliants, hot showers, or tight clothing that could further irritate the skin. Instead, apply soothing products like aloe vera or hyaluronic acid to calm the skin and support its natural recovery process.

Comparatively, while red light therapy is generally safe, other post-waxing treatments like chemical peels or intense exfoliation should be avoided for at least 72 hours. Red light therapy stands out as a gentler option, but timing remains key. For instance, if you’re using a home red light device, start with shorter sessions (5–10 minutes) and gradually increase duration as your skin adapts. Professional treatments, which often use higher-intensity devices, may require a longer wait time to ensure safety.

Practically, incorporating red light therapy after waxing can enhance skin recovery when timed correctly. For example, if you wax in the evening, wait until the following evening to begin therapy. Use a device with adjustable settings to start at a lower intensity, especially if your skin feels tender. Pairing this treatment with a cooling gel or lightweight moisturizer can further enhance comfort and results. By respecting your skin’s recovery timeline, you can safely harness the benefits of red light therapy without risking additional irritation.

Skin Sensitivity: How waxing affects skin sensitivity and red light therapy tolerance

Waxing strips away not only hair but also the outermost layer of dead skin cells, leaving the skin temporarily raw and vulnerable. This immediate post-wax sensitivity is a critical factor when considering red light therapy, a treatment known for its anti-inflammatory and healing properties. The skin’s barrier function is compromised after waxing, making it more susceptible to irritation from external stimuli, including light-based therapies. Understanding this interplay is essential for anyone looking to combine these two treatments safely.

From an analytical perspective, the skin’s response to waxing can be broken down into phases. The first 24–48 hours post-wax are marked by increased blood flow, mild inflammation, and heightened sensitivity. During this window, the skin is in a reactive state, and introducing red light therapy—which operates at wavelengths of 630–660 nm (red) and 810–850 nm (near-infrared)—could either soothe or exacerbate the condition depending on timing and dosage. For instance, a low-intensity red light session (10–20 J/cm²) might aid in reducing inflammation, but higher intensities could overwhelm the already stressed skin.

Instructively, if you’re determined to incorporate red light therapy after waxing, follow these steps: wait at least 24 hours post-wax to allow the skin to recover partially, start with a shorter session (5–10 minutes), and monitor for signs of increased redness or discomfort. For facial waxing, use a red light device with a lower irradiance setting (around 50 mW/cm²) to minimize risk. Always cleanse the skin gently before treatment to remove any residual wax or oils that could interfere with light penetration.

Comparatively, while red light therapy is generally safe for post-wax skin, it’s not the only option for calming irritation. Alternatives like aloe vera gel or chamomile compresses can provide immediate relief without the risk of overstimulation. However, red light therapy offers the added benefit of stimulating collagen production and accelerating healing, making it a compelling choice for those willing to wait and proceed cautiously.

Practically, age and skin type play a role in tolerance levels. Younger skin (ages 18–30) typically recovers faster from waxing and may tolerate red light therapy sooner than mature skin (ages 40+), which tends to be thinner and more sensitive. Individuals with conditions like rosacea or eczema should avoid combining these treatments altogether, as both waxing and red light therapy can trigger flare-ups. Always consult a dermatologist if you’re unsure about your skin’s ability to handle this combination.

Potential Risks: Possible side effects of combining red light therapy with freshly waxed skin

Combining red light therapy with freshly waxed skin may seem like a convenient way to soothe irritation and enhance results, but it carries potential risks that warrant caution. Waxing removes hair by stripping the top layer of dead skin cells, leaving the skin temporarily sensitive and vulnerable. Red light therapy, while generally gentle, penetrates the skin to stimulate cellular repair and reduce inflammation. When applied immediately after waxing, the therapy’s intensity could exacerbate skin sensitivity, leading to heightened discomfort or adverse reactions. Understanding this interaction is crucial for anyone considering this combination.

One immediate concern is increased skin irritation. Waxing already causes micro-trauma to the skin, and the heat from red light therapy, even at low wavelengths (typically 630–660 nm for red light), can further inflame the area. This may manifest as redness, itching, or a burning sensation, particularly in sensitive areas like the face, bikini line, or underarms. For individuals with pre-existing skin conditions such as eczema or rosacea, the risk of flare-ups is significantly higher. Waiting at least 24–48 hours post-waxing allows the skin to recover, reducing the likelihood of these side effects.

Another risk lies in the potential for prolonged redness or hyperpigmentation. Red light therapy is often praised for its anti-inflammatory properties, but when applied to freshly waxed skin, it may disrupt the skin’s natural healing process. The therapy’s stimulation of blood flow and collagen production could inadvertently prolong inflammation or trigger melanin overproduction, especially in darker skin tones. This can result in uneven skin tone or dark spots, which may take weeks to fade. To minimize this risk, consider patch-testing a small area before full treatment and using lower-intensity settings if proceeding.

Lastly, there’s the possibility of bacterial infection. Waxing creates open follicles, making the skin more susceptible to bacteria. While red light therapy has antimicrobial properties, it is not a substitute for proper post-waxing hygiene. If the skin is not thoroughly cleansed before therapy, bacteria trapped in the follicles could multiply, leading to folliculitis or other infections. Always cleanse the skin with a gentle, non-irritating cleanser and avoid applying lotions or oils before treatment to reduce this risk.

In summary, while red light therapy can be beneficial, its combination with freshly waxed skin requires careful consideration. Waiting at least 24–48 hours, monitoring skin reactions, and maintaining proper hygiene are essential steps to mitigate potential risks. If in doubt, consult a dermatologist to determine the safest approach for your skin type and condition.
